Calton House has an exciting new opportunity for a Care Manager to join our team at Calton House LTD. Whether you are wanting to take the next step in your career or already have the skill set required for the post, then we want to hear from you

At Calton we are passionate about providing person centred support to a variety of individuals with learning disabilities, autism, behaviours that may challenge and mental health conditions. These individuals can either live in their own home or live in a property where multiple service users reside.

As a Care Manager you will lead, coach and nurture your team to achieve the best outcomes as a team and for those we support

You'll collaborate and communicate effectively with the individuals your team supports, their families and loved ones, and with allied professionals.

Dedicated to undertaking the management of supporting individuals, your team will support service users in your care to achieve their goals in life and will actively seek out opportunities for them to develop their skills and confidence through a variety of staff involvement, activities and other initiatives.

Committed to quality assurance, you will effectively lead and inspire your team to provide the highest quality person-centred support. The successful candidate will be responsible for delivering best practice.
